The ingredients needed to make Pork Tenderloin Poached in a Pork Cream Sauce:
  1. Prepare 1 whole pork tenderloin
  2. Get 2 cup pork stock or broth (if you do not have pork broth subsitute with 1 cup low or no sodium chicken broth and 1 cup low or no sodium beef broth ) If you want to make a pork stock I have a recipe on my profile.
  3. Get 1/4 cup dry white wine
  4. Prepare 1 cup heavy cream
  5. Get 4 clove minced garlic
  6. Make ready 1 tbsp hot sauce such as franks brand
  7. Take 1/2 tsp black pepper and salt to taste
  8. Take 2 tbsp grated romano or parmesan cheese
  9. Get 1 tsp lemon juice
  10. Take 4 sliced green onions
  11. Get 1 tbsp olive oil
  12. Take 1 tsp cajun seasoning
Steps to make Pork Tenderloin Poached in a Pork Cream Sauce:
  1. Season pork tenderloin with cajun seasoning. Heat oil in dutch oven sear pork on all sides remove to a plate. In dutch oven deglaze pan with white wine, reducing until almost gone, whisk in broth, cream, hot sauce, garlic and lemon juice, bring to a boil then reduce to a very low simmer, add pork to liquid, cover and poach about 15 minutes ( turning twice ) depending on thickness of pork. The internal temperature should be 140 to 145. Remove pork to plate, cover and let rest. Meanwhile increase heat to get the sauce to a boil and reduce to a creamy sauce.Whisk in romano cheese.
  2. Slice pork into 1/2 inch slices add sauce garnish with green onions and a sprinkle of roman cheese.
  3. Serve this with mashed potatos, rice or pasta for all the wonderful sauce!
